Snapshot Testing

UI components at Bracken & Vale are snapshot-tested with our in-house tool, Mirrorframe. Run the suite locally before every push; stale snapshots fail CI. Update snapshots only when the visual change is intentional, and mention it in your PR description. Publishing an approved snapshot baseline to the shared registry requires signing, so use the key listed just below.

deploy key for kajof-fajop: bky6_gDHw9Q

## Ticket-pricing experiment: dynamic floor adjustment

This PR wires the Farelane pricing service into the new experiment framework so we can test a dynamic price floor for off-peak shows at the Brumley venue group. Assignment happens at cart creation and is sticky per session. Nothing here changes checkout logic; only the quoted price varies. All experiment behavior is governed by the constants listed below.

tuning table, yajog-yahof:
BUDGETS = {
    "lamvan": 303,
    "wenox": 460,
    "fenvan": 525,
}

**Action item (PM-07):** The Snapwell upload pipeline failed to strip EXIF GPS data from images processed through the legacy resize path, exposing location metadata for roughly three weeks. Remediation: route all uploads through the Scrubbit sanitizer and delete the legacy path entirely. Owner: Priya, due next release. Verification steps for the security review are documented here:

runbook for badug-kadup: https://confluence.zemvarlabs.internal/projects/browse/display/projects/bd1b

## Local Setup — Cron Drift Investigation

To reproduce the Pellwick scheduler drift locally, install the repro harness, seed the fake clock tables, and run `make drift-sim`. Logs land in `./out/drift`. Compare tick offsets against the `expected_fire` column. The harness needs read access to the scheduler metadata database; point it at the following connection string.

primary connection of tadup-tagep = mongodb://fendor_svc:6hZCOAA@db-14a7.plorvaworks.test:5432/giliel

## Changelog — v3.8.1 (key rotation)

Heads up, plugin folks: we've rotated the signing key for the Shelfwright catalogue import pipeline. If your plugin validates import bundles from Bindery Cloud, the old key stops working at the end of this cycle — no grace period after that, sorry. MARC-ish record parsing is unchanged, so no code updates needed beyond swapping the trust anchor. Update your verification config to use the key below.

release key, fajef-kajeg: bky19_LdLu6Ne6FLi8he2c24d